Emerald City Opera
Closed
320 S Lincoln Ave
Steamboat Springs, CO 80487
Opera Steamboat, located in Steamboat Springs, Colorado, was founded in 2002 as a nonprofit opera company dedicated to bringing world-class musical arts programs to the Rocky Mountains.
Their mission is to enrich the well-being of the community through the transformative power of opera and the performing arts.
Generated from their website's infomation
Also at this address
See a problem?
You might also like
Partial Data by Infogroup (c) 2025. All rights reserved.
Partial Data by Foursquare.